You may be right about Omega-K. But if they indeed have been reconsitituted, then they no longer have a website, as the one I used to have bookmarked no longer worked.

Based on your and David's answers, there appears to be a relationship between four companies: Omega-K, ICM, ZV Models, and MAC distribution. And as you say, now also Industry Cleaning (actually the truck you sent to me was labelled Industry Cleaning).

I will have to get one of the Omega/ICM/ZV/MAC URAL-4320s to compare side-by-side to the -375, and see what all is different. You mention the exhaust, and David mentions the front grill; maybe there are a couple other minor points. The 4320 I have is the AER kit, which everyone agrees is inferior.
